#876 Avoid empty lines in LAS export file

This commit is contained in:
Jacob Støren
2016-09-13 11:47:42 +02:00
parent ba0a3b53f5
commit cdfec7a04f

View File

@@ -473,7 +473,7 @@ void LasWell::WriteToFile(const std::string & filename,
for (size_t i = 0; i < comment_header.size(); ++i) {
file << "# " << comment_header[i] << "\n";
}
file << "\n";
file << "#\n";
// Version information
file << "~Version information\n";
@@ -481,7 +481,7 @@ void LasWell::WriteToFile(const std::string & filename,
WriteLasLine(file, "WRAP", "", (wrap_ ? "YES" : "NO"), "");
for(size_t i=0;i<version_info_.size();i++)
file << version_info_[i] << "\n";
file << "\n";
file << "#\n";
file.setf(std::ios_base::fixed);
file.precision(5);
@@ -494,7 +494,7 @@ void LasWell::WriteToFile(const std::string & filename,
WriteLasLine(file, "NULL", "", GetContMissing(), "");
for(size_t i=0;i<well_info_.size();i++)
file << well_info_[i] << "\n";
file << "\n";
file << "#\n";
if (GetNContLog() == 0) {
// No log data in file.
@@ -505,7 +505,7 @@ void LasWell::WriteToFile(const std::string & filename,
file << "~Parameter information\n";
for(size_t i=0;i<parameter_info_.size();i++)
file << parameter_info_[i] << "\n";
file << "\n";
file << "#\n";
// Curve information
@@ -515,7 +515,7 @@ void LasWell::WriteToFile(const std::string & filename,
for (size_t i = 0; i < GetNContLog(); ++i) {
WriteLasLine(file, log_name_[i], log_unit_[i], "", log_comment_[i]);
}
file << "\n";
file << "#\n";
// Data section
file << "~Ascii\n";